Protein-centric diets are gaining popularity as society becomes more aware of the impact of nutrition on our bodies. The Progressive Protein Approach involves gradually increasing daily protein intake until it reaches 20% less than the target bodyweight in grams of protein. This approach offers numerous benefits, including enhanced muscle growth and recovery, weight management, improved metabolism, and optimal nutrient intake. It is important to consult with a healthcare professional or dietitian before making significant changes to your diet.
Key Takeaways:
* Protein is an essential nutrient that forms the building blocks of our bodies and plays a crucial role in various bodily functions.
* The Progressive Protein Approach involves gradually increasing protein intake until it reaches 20% less than the target bodyweight in grams of protein.
* Benefits of progressive protein intake include enhanced muscle growth and recovery, weight management, improved metabolism, and optimal nutrient intake.
* Protein-rich diets increase feelings of satiety, leading to reduced calorie intake and aiding in weight loss.
* Consuming more protein can increase the total number of calories burned in a day due to the higher thermic effect of food.
* Progressive protein intake allows the body to adjust gradually, optimizing absorption and preventing potential side effects.
